For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 135 students in 67752, KS.
The top ranked public high school in 67752, KS is Quinter Jr-sr High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high school in zipcode 67752 have an average math proficiency score of 32% (versus the Kansas public high school average of 21%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 26% statewide average). High schools in 67752, KS have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Kansas public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 67752 have a Graduation Rate of 80%, which is less than the Kansas average of 88%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Quinter Jr-sr High School, with ≥80%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Kansas or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Kansas public high school average of 37% (majority Hispanic).
